The global Prescription Drugs Market Growth is experiencing strong momentum driven by incre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, rising healthcare expenditure, and continuous pharmaceutical innovation. According to industry analysis, the prescription drugs market size is projected to expand from US 1440.79 billion in 2024 to US 2350.12 billion by 2031, registering a compound annual growth rate of 7.3 percent during the forecast period 2025 to 2031.
This growth reflects the rising global dependency on prescription medications for managing conditions such as cardiovascular diseases, diabetes, cancer, respiratory disorders, and neurological illnesses. The increasing aging population and growing awareness about early disease diagnosis are further accelerating market demand across developed and emerging economies.

Market Overview and Key Growth Drivers
One of the major drivers of the prescription drugs market is the increasing global burden of chronic and lifestyle-related diseases. Conditions such as hypertension, diabetes, and cancer require long-term medication, significantly contributing to rising prescription drug consumption.
Another critical factor fueling market growth is the continuous advancement in drug development technologies. Pharmaceutical companies are investing heavily in research and development to introduce novel therapies, including biologics, biosimilars, and targeted drugs. These innovations are improving treatment efficacy while reducing side effects.
Additionally, expanding healthcare access in developing regions is boosting prescription drug adoption. Governments and healthcare organizations are improving insurance coverage, reimbursement policies, and public health infrastructure, enabling more patients to access essential medicines.
The rise of digital health platforms and e-prescriptions is also transforming the pharmaceutical landscape. Patients are increasingly using online consultations and digital pharmacies, which is streamlining drug distribution and improving accessibility.
Market Segmentation Insights
The prescription drugs market is segmented based on drug type, therapeutic application, and distribution channel.
By drug type, branded drugs continue to dominate the market due to strong patent protection and high efficacy. However, the generic drugs segment is witnessing rapid growth due to affordability and increasing government support for cost-effective healthcare solutions.
Based on therapeutic application, key segments include cardiovascular diseases, oncology, diabetes, respiratory disorders, central nervous system disorders, and others. Among these, oncology and cardiovascular segments hold a significant market share due to rising disease prevalence globally.
In terms of distribution channels, hospital pharmacies, retail pharmacies, and online pharmacies play a vital role. Retail pharmacies currently dominate, while online pharmacies are expected to grow at a faster rate due to increasing digital adoption and convenience.

Market Trends and Future Outlook
One of the most significant trends shaping the prescription drugs market is the growing adoption of personalized medicine. Pharmaceutical companies are increasingly focusing on developing drugs tailored to individual genetic profiles, improving treatment effectiveness and reducing adverse reactions.
Another key trend is the rise of biologics and biosimilars. These advanced therapies are gaining popularity due to their high precision in treating complex diseases, particularly in oncology and autoimmune disorders.
The integ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ning in drug discovery is also transforming the pharmaceutical industry. These technologies are reducing drug development timelines, lowering costs, and improving success rates in clinical trials.
Furthermore, the expansion of digital healthcare ecosystems is enhancing patient access to prescription medications. Telemedicine, online pharmacies, and digital prescriptions are becoming increasingly common, especially in urban populations.
Regional Analysis
North America holds the largest share of the global prescription drugs market due to advanced healthcare infrastructure, high healthcare spending, and strong presence of leading pharmaceutical companies. The United States, in particular, dominates drug innovation and consumption.
Europe follows closely, supported by robust healthcare systems and strong regulatory frameworks that promote drug safety and innovation.
Meanwhile, the Asia Pacific region is expected to witness the fastest growth during the forecast period. Factors such as increasing population, rising disposable income, expanding healthcare infrastructure, and growing awareness of chronic diseases are driving regional demand. Countries like China, India, and Japan are emerging as key pharmaceutical manufacturing and consumption hubs.
Challenges in the Market
Despite strong growth prospects, the prescription drugs market faces several challenges. High drug development costs and lengthy regulatory approval processes can delay product launches. Additionally, patent expirations and increasing competition from generics pose significant revenue pressure for branded drug manufacturers.
Concerns related to drug pricing and affordability also remain a major issue in many regions. Governments are implementing strict pricing regulations, which can impact pharmaceutical profitability.
